Recovering From Burnout

from Flagship: Claiming new territories in the ungoverned areas of your mental health · host Joshua Stegenga

In a world that puts a high value on successful performance, we have to be very self-aware of what basic need our feelings are trying to point out. When we keep giving into the demands of life and suppressing our felt needs, it can quickly lead to burnout damaging our self-image, and attitude, lowering our expectations, leading to poor behavior and ultimately self-hatred. In this episode we talk about what burnout feels like, how it happens, and how to recovery from it.
